Solving the Equation: Distributing, Simplifying, and Isolating the Variable

2(3x + 1) = 7x – 5

To solve this equation, we will distribute the 2 to the terms inside the parentheses on the left side of the equation.

2 * 3x = 6x
2 * 1 = 2

After distributing 2 to the terms in the parentheses, the equation becomes:

6x + 2 = 7x – 5

Next, we will isolate the variable x on one side of the equation. To do this, we can subtract 6x from both sides of the equation:

6x + 2 – 6x = 7x – 5 – 6x

After simplification, the equation becomes:

2 = x – 5

Now, let’s isolate x by adding 5 to both sides of the equation:

2 + 5 = x – 5 + 5

After simplification, we have:

7 = x

So the solution to the equation is x = 7.
